2 injured in Glassport crash
Two people were injured Wednesday morning in a crash in Glassport, according to Allegheny County 911.
Officials said the crash happened just after 12:45 a.m. on the 700 block of Hemlock Way.
Two people were taken to the hospital.
Pirates to assist with blood drive incentives
Vitalant, a nonprofit blood and biotherapies health care company based in Pittsburgh, will extend its August blood drive initiative with help from the Pittsburgh Pirates.
The organizations are partnering to address the ongoing blood shortage for the second time this year to host the second and final round of blood drives for 2024. In May, they collected an impressive 657 blood donations together.
Individuals who give blood at one of Vitalant’s Pittsburgh Pirates Blood Drives will receive a voucher redeemable for two free Pirates home game tickets, applicable for games on Sunday through Thursday. All donors who give blood through Aug. 29 will also receive a $10 gift card via Door Rewards and will be automatically entered for a chance to win one of two $10,000 gift cards.
Blood drives will be held Aug. 19, 20 and 21 from 10:30 a.m. to 6 p.m. at PNC Park at North Shore, Press Conference Room 115 Federal St. Pittsburgh, PA 15212
